Measurement of Cable Tension by Laser Vibrometer and Applicability Evaluation of Non-contact Vibration Measurement Method
신현섭 ( Hyun Seop Shin ) , 박기태 ( Ki Tae Park ) , 전진택 ( Jin Taek Jun )
UCI I410-ECN-0102-2014-500-001864411

In this study cable tension of existing bridges is measured by non-contact laser vibrometer, and applicability of a non-contact vibration measurement method is experimentally evaluated. Cable tension of two existing cable bridges is measured by laser vibrometer, and test results are analyzed and compared with evaluation results acquired by using accelerometer. According to the analysis results, cable tension of existing bridge can be efficiently measured by non-contact vibrometer in a relative short time. Furthermore, the non-contact vibration measurement method reveals an error of less than 5 percent, and could be efficiently applied to a tendency analysis of tension values or to a rapid measurement in construction sites.
